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are easy, cost-efficient doors with a versatile flap that the cat presses through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ors require the cat to wear a magnetic collar, preventing unwanted animals from getting in.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most safe and secure and advanced options, reading your cat's microchip to permit entry just to your pet, staying out stray animals and preserving home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ors utilize a tunnel extension to bridge the gap.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most common installation place.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into different types of wood doors, consisting of solid core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ass requires specialized skills and tools. Experts can safely cut circular or rectangular holes in glass panels, guaranteeing structural stability and a clean surface.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be installed in walls, typically leading to basements or garages. This requires proficiency in wall construction and framing.Patio Area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io doors or moving glass doors, often by changing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can likewise accommodate cat doors, allowing ventilation while supplying p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:
The cost of professional cat door installation can vary depending on a number of factors:
Type of Cat Door: More advanced doors like microchip designs may have a somewhat greater cat-friendly housing installation cost due to their complexity.cat-friendly housing install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is normally more complex and may cost more than installing in a basic wooden door.Intricacy of the Job: If modifications to the door frame or surrounding structure are needed, this can increase the general c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can differ depending on their experience, area, and local market value.
It's constantly best to get a comprehensive quote from the installer before continuing, laying out all expenses involved.
